Munagala at a glance

Munagala is a village of 2,880 people in 602 households (Census 2011) in Gudur mandal, Kurnool district, Andhra Pradesh, the 5th-largest of 11 villages in Gudur mandal. Literacy is 35%, 11 points below the mandal average of 46% and the sex ratio is 935 women per 1,000 men. It lies 34 km from the Kurnool district centre, 5 km from Gudur, the nearest town, 24 km from Dupadu railway station (straight-line distances). The pincode is 518466, served by Gudur (Kurnool) post office; the LGD village code is 593872. The nearest hospital or health centre is Raja Saheb Clinic, 4 km away. The village votes in Kodumur assembly constituency, represented by MLA Boggula Dastagiri. The population is estimated at 3,396 in 2026, up 18% since the 2011 Census.
